Changelog — Ferrowisp export retries (for Wednesday's sync). We bumped the defaults after last month's pile-ups: retries now back off exponentially instead of hammering the Dunmoor endpoint every 30 seconds, and we cap attempts at five before parking the export in the dead-letter queue. Should cut the noisy-alert volume a lot. The new default configuration the worker ships with is below.

deployment values, kajep-kageg:
[praix]
host = praix.paliqcorp.corp
user = praix_svc
database = praix_prod

MINUTES — Management Meeting, Pricing Review: Lumeno Line

Attendees: R. Vasque, P. Thornby, A. Keld. Quick session on Lumeno pricing. Consensus: the entry tier is too cheap — customers upgrade slower than expected. Petra proposed a 12% bump on the base model and holding the Pro tier flat. Arlo wants margin modelling before we commit; finance, that's on you by Thursday. Rough numbers suggest it's worth it. One confidential note for your files:

management briefing: The southern region missed its Oliox quota by 51.7 percent last quarter. Juldorek Freight plans to raise the Silath list price by 49.7 percent in January. The board signed off on a budget of $388.0 million for Project Casok. The renewal with Fradorix Foods closes at $53.0 million a year, 49.8 percent below the last contract.

Runbook 4.2 — Account recovery after bulk admin edits (Tindervale console)

If a bulk edit in the admin table disables accounts by mistake, do not re-run the edit. Export the affected rows first, verify timestamps against the audit log, then restore from the pre-edit snapshot one batch at a time. Unlocking the snapshot tool requires the recovery passphrase that appears below.

recovery phrase for kahap-tajog: oliwyn-istox